Planned Parenthood Golden Gate v. Garibaldi
California Court of Appeals
132 Cal. Rptr. 2d 46 (2003)
Planned Parenthood (plaintiff) obtained a 1995 permanent injunction against Operation Rescue of California and Robert Cochran restricting anti-abortion clinic protest activity, with the injunction also purporting to apply to anyone acting in concert with them or anyone with actual notice of it. In 2001, Planned Parenthood sought a declaration that the injunction bound Rossi Foti and Jeannette and Louie Garibaldi (defendants), who were not original parties, and the trial court granted summary judgment enforcing the injunction against them; Foti and the Garibaldis appealed.
Whether an injunction must be directed against specific persons or classes of persons based on their own past actions in a specific dispute between real parties, applying only to those persons or classes, rather than to anyone with mere notice of it.
